The classic, light-hearted series of children's stories written by Gilbert Delahaye and Marcel Marlier and translated into Arabic. Tuline is a sweet girl who loves animals and is always kind to others. This colorful, hardcover book is a collection of six Tuline stories in fully voweled text for easier reading.
